| Reverse description | Two emperor penguins (Aptenodytes forsteri) standing upright side by side on a stylised ice floe, rendered in frosted high relief against a mirror-polished field. The birds are depicted in naturalistic detail, with characteristic yellow-orange auricular patches and white chest plumage finely articulated. The legend 'EMPEROR PENGUIN' arcs across the upper field in bold capital letters, while the silver specification 'Ag.999.1oz' appears in smaller incuse lettering below the central device. The denomination '£1' is inscribed in the lower field, and a small 'P' privy mark of the Pobjoy Mint is visible to the right of the central motif. |
